ThatOneBigKid wrote:Picked up the Luk kit off ebay. 425 shipped to the house :( Going to install the weekend of the 14th. Any tips or tricks to dropping the tranny?

@ FORDSVTPARTS - Do you have Flywheel bolts in stock for the 6 speed? (not sure if they are different from the 5 speed) I have heard that they should be replaced when the clutch is replaced. Do you recomend this.
$2.75 each and we do stock them, If you don't replace them be sure to use Loc-tite on the old bolts when you install them.

They are unique to the SVT.

ThatOneBigKid wrote:Picked up the Luk kit off ebay. 425 shipped to the house :( Going to install the weekend of the 14th. Any tips or tricks to dropping the tranny?

@ FORDSVTPARTS - Do you have Flywheel bolts in stock for the 6 speed? (not sure if they are different from the 5 speed) I have heard that they should be replaced when the clutch is replaced. Do you recomend this.
Rent an engine hoist to lift the trans in and out, it makes life a hell of a lot easier. You will need to rotate the trans counter clockwise to get it past the subframe (k-member). I also found this thread on focal jet to be helpful.
